The Hesarghatta mosquito forecast shows peak mosquito activity during the monsoon months of June through August, with forecast ratings reaching up to 9 out of 10. The dry months like January and December see much lower activity, around 2. This seasonal pattern aligns with the increased humidity and water accumulation in the region, including near the famous Hesaraghatta Lake. Several factors influence mosquito populations around Hesarghatta. The area's subtropical climate, combined with the presence of water bodies like Hesaraghatta Lake, creates ideal breeding grounds. Key influences include: - Rainfall patterns, especially during the monsoon season - Temperature fluctuations, which affect mosquito life cycles - Vegetation density providing shelter Additionally, stagnant water in agricultural fields and urban drainage can increase mosquito breeding. Hesarghatta, like much of Karnataka, faces risks from mosquito-borne illnesses such as dengue, chikungunya, and malaria. These diseases are transmitted primarily by Aedes and Anopheles mosquitoes, which thrive in the region's climate. Symptoms can range from mild fever to severe complications.
